Web3 feb. 2024 · The formula to calculate the monthly employee turnover rate is: (Employees who left in a month / average number of employees in a month) x 100 = monthly … Web5 mei 2024 · To calculate profit, simply deduct costs; for net profit, deduct all other expenses, including tax. For example, if your turnover is £100,000 and the cost of the goods sold are £20,000, gross profit is £80,000. Once you take operating costs of say £10,000 into account, you’re left with a net profit of £70,000.

WebYou’ll need to calculate your business turnover when completing out your self-assessment tax return, totalling up everything you have earned in the tax year. The figures you use must be gross, which means before deductions. So, if you are a self-employed uber driver, for example, you’ll need to add up your income before any Uber deductions.
